Artwork Gallery of Ontario goes massive with plans for brand new Trendy and up to date wing



The rumours of an Artwork Gallery of Ontario (AGO) growth had been swirling for some time, however now it’s a accomplished deal. The Toronto museum introduced on 27 April that it has contracted Selldorf Architects, Diamond Schmitt and Brian Porter’s Two Row Architect to spearhead the design section of what it’s calling AGO International Up to date, a 50,000 sq. ft showplace for the gallery’s in depth Trendy and up to date artwork assortment.

Based on AGO chief government Stephan Jost, International Up to date compares favorably in dimension to the Whitney Museum of American Artwork in New York. “It’s not a small mission,” Jost says. “We’ve got international ambitions. We’ll assist our guests see the world otherwise.”

The price of the brand new addition just isn’t but identified, in accordance with a museum spokesperson. “Figuring out the overall value of constructing the growth is an final result of the present design section,” the spokesperson says.

This marks the AGO’s seventh growth in its 122-year historical past and first since Frank Gehry remodeled the gallery in 2008.

It was to be anticipated that an assemblage of abilities would win the day, Jost says, noting that bidders utilized as groups. It’s fairly the trio, Selldorf being a frontrunner in gallery and museum design with the transformation of rail yard warehouses at Luma Arles in France and the continuing growth of New York’s Frick Assortment amongst its ventures, whereas Diamond Schmitt boasts David Geffen Corridor at Lincoln Heart and Toronto’s Ryerson Picture Centre. Two Row Architect’s Fort Severn Resilient Duplex mission snared the prize for social fairness design.

However there’s a lot to be accomplished if the hoped-for launch date of 2026-27 is to be realised. “Hiring the architect is actual, however there’s a great distance between right here and chopping the ribbon,” Jost says. “If every part goes actually, very well, we’ll break floor in two years. There are such a lot of bridges to cross.”

The AGO can very a lot use the extra house, Jost says, noting that its assortment is rising quickly and extra treasures are prone to comply with. “It is a versatile house,” he says. “We want the house to soak up future items—a whole lot of extraordinary artwork has been bought by Toronto individuals.”

Annabelle Selldorf is heading the design staff. Amongst her agency’s different shoppers are the Smithsonian American Artwork Museum, London’s Nationwide Gallery and the just lately expanded Museum of Up to date Artwork San Diego.

Diamond Schmitt, with workplaces in New York, Toronto and Vancouver, can be credited with Buddy Holly Corridor in Lubbock, Texas, the Emily Carr College of Artwork + Design in Vancouver, the Nationwide Arts Centre and Ingenium Centre in Ottawa and La Maison Symphonique de Montréal.

Two Row Architect’s resume contains the Nationwide Centre of Indigenous Legal guidelines on the College of Victoria and the Indigenous Pupil Centre at Seneca School’s Newnham Campus, in addition to a number of extra initiatives within the US.

The AGO mission will bear a evaluate course of and remaining approval by the museum’s board of trustees, with a public presentation prone to comply with later this yr.
